Best Practices for Professional Email Signature in United Technologies Emails

In a corporate environment like United Technologies, an email signature is more than just a closing statement; it's an integral part of professional communication. A well-crafted signature reflects the company’s brand, ensures clarity of information, and contributes to consistency across employee emails. Establishing clear guidelines for email signatures can help streamline communication and present a unified, professional image both internally and externally.

When designing your email signature, it's crucial to maintain a balance between necessary information and simplicity. Overloading the signature with excessive details or graphics can distract from the core message and create a cluttered impression. Instead, focus on including key contact details and company branding elements while keeping the layout clean and easy to read.

Key Components of an Effective Email Signature

  • Full Name: Include your first and last name for easy identification.
  • Job Title: Clearly state your role to provide context to your correspondence.
  • Company Name: Mention United Technologies to reinforce the brand.
  • Contact Information: Include your work phone number, email address, and possibly your office location.
  • Company Website: Provide a direct link to the United Technologies website for further information.

Formatting Guidelines

To maintain a professional appearance, follow these formatting rules:

  1. Use Standard Font: Stick to standard, legible fonts like Arial or Calibri to ensure readability across devices.
  2. Limit Font Size: Keep the font size between 10-12px to avoid overwhelming the reader.
  3. Avoid Overuse of Colors: Use one or two accent colors that align with the company’s branding.
  4. Use a Simple Logo: If including a logo, ensure it is small and does not overpower the text.

How to Efficiently Manage Your Inbox for United Technologies Email Accounts

Organizing your email inbox effectively is crucial for staying on top of important communications. For users of United Technologies email accounts, implementing a clear structure can significantly improve productivity and minimize the risk of missing critical messages. By setting up appropriate folders, creating filters, and regularly cleaning your inbox, you can create a streamlined and efficient system that supports your daily workflow.

To organize your United Technologies email account efficiently, it's important to adopt a few key practices. Categorizing emails into folders and using labels to flag high-priority messages will help you maintain focus and avoid clutter. Additionally, setting up automated rules to sort emails based on criteria like sender, subject, or urgency can save time and reduce manual organization tasks.

Steps to Structure Your Inbox Effectively

  • Create Dedicated Folders: Organize emails into categories such as "Project Updates", "HR", "Finance", and "Client Communications". This will allow you to easily locate important messages.
  • Use Email Filters: Set up filters to automatically move emails from specific senders or with particular keywords into predefined folders.
  • Flag Important Emails: Use flags or labels to mark critical messages, so you can prioritize them and address them first.
  • Set Up Automated Replies: For days when you are unavailable, set up an out-of-office reply to ensure that people are aware of your absence.

Tips for Maintaining an Organized Inbox

  1. Regularly clean out unnecessary emails by archiving or deleting old messages that no longer serve a purpose.
  2. Use a consistent naming convention for your folders, so you can quickly identify their contents.
  3. Periodically review your filters to ensure they are still relevant and effectively organizing your emails.

Important: Remember to periodically back up critical emails and folders to avoid any data loss in case of technical issues.

Troubleshooting Common Problems with United Technologies Email

Issues with United Technologies email accounts can occur due to various reasons such as incorrect configurations, connectivity issues, or problems with email servers. To resolve these problems efficiently, it is important to follow a systematic approach and check common troubleshooting steps before seeking further assistance. Below are some practical steps to help you resolve frequent email-related issues.

Here are some of the most common email problems and their solutions:

Email Connectivity Issues

If you are unable to send or receive emails, follow these steps:

  • Ensure your internet connection is stable.
  • Check if the mail server settings (IMAP, SMTP) are correctly configured.
  • Verify your login credentials (username and password) for accuracy.
  • Check if your email provider's server is down or undergoing maintenance.

Email Not Syncing Properly

If your email account is not syncing properly, try the following:

  1. Log out and log back into your account.
  2. Refresh the account settings or delete and re-add the account.
  3. Clear cache or temporary files on your device.

Important: Always keep your email client up to date to avoid compatibility issues with server protocols.

Issues with Email Attachments

If you're facing issues with sending or receiving attachments, follow these checks:

  • Ensure the file size does not exceed the server's attachment limit.
  • Verify the file format is supported by the email service.
  • Check if your email service is blocking attachments due to security policies.
